Understand the importance of gutter maintenance in Pittsburgh
Gutter maintenance in Pittsburgh is essential for keeping your home safe and dry! Neglecting to maintain your gutters can lead to serious issues, including roof damage, water damage in your basement or crawl space, and foundation problems. To avoid these costly repairs, it's important to be proactive with your gutter maintenance! (Luckily,) there are several simple steps you can take to keep them in good shape.
First of all, inspect your gutters regularly. This should be done at least twice a year; once in the spring before the heavy rain arrives, and again in the fall after leaves have fallen. Clear out any debris that has accumulated while looking for signs of rust or wear-and-tear. Additionally, make sure all downspouts are directed away from the foundations of your home so that water won't accumulate near its base. (Moreover,) if you notice plants growing on the surface of your gutters or downspouts it's time for some trimming!
Another important part of maintaining your gutters is ensuring they're secure and properly attached to your house. Loose fasteners should be tightened and missing spikes replaced as soon as possible to ensure stability during heavy rains. Lastly, check for any breaks or holes along the length of the gutter itself--these need to be patched up promptly with caulk or sealant material in order to protect against leaks and other damages caused by water accumulation.

Choose the right materials for your gutters
Maintaining your gutters in Pittsburgh requires careful consideration of the materials you choose! Steel, aluminum, or vinyl are all popular options, but it's essential to pick the right one for your home. Steel is the strongest and most durable material available, but it can be prone to rust (especially in humid environments like Pittsburgh!) and require frequent painting. Aluminum is lightweight and corrosion-resistant, but not as strong as steel. Vinyl is a cost-effective option, however; it's not as long-lasting and may require more frequent cleaning than other materials. All three materials offer different levels of protection against water damage - steel offers the best protection but costs more upfront.

Install gutters correctly
Installing gutters correctly is essential for maintaining your gutters in Pittsburgh. It's important to use the right materials and tools to ensure proper installation (and avoid costly repairs later!). First, make sure you're using high-quality aluminum or vinyl gutters; these are durable and won't rust or corrode over time. Then you'll need a ladder, tape measure, level, hacksaw, sealant, screws & gutter hangers. Begin by measuring the length of the fascia boards on each side of your house and cut the gutter sections to size. Once they're cut and fitted with end caps, it's time to hang them up! Start at one end of the house and attach a hanger every 2 feet along the fascia board. Use a level to make sure they're even and secure them with screws. Finally, connect all the pieces together using sealant and you're done!
(But don't forget!) Check for any leaks around joints - if there are any gaps add more sealant as needed! Repair or replace broken or damaged parts ASAP
Gutter maintenance is an important part of keeping your Pittsburgh home safe and sound. Neglecting to take care of them can lead to costly repairs down the line! So, it's wise to inspect your gutters regularly, and repair or replace any broken or damaged parts right away (ASAP). Doing regular checks can help prevent future problems and save you money in the long run.
To begin with, remove leaves and debris from your gutters with a shovel or trowel. This will ensure that water flows freely down the spout. In addition, use a ladder to check for misshaped sections. If you find any imperfections, swiftly mend them with some caulk or sealant before they turn into bigger issues!
Furthermore, look out for signs of rust on metal gutters which could weaken them over time if left untreated. If you spot corrosion, consider repairing by applying a rust-inhibiting primer followed by paint or an epoxy sealer for extra protection. Otherwise, consider replacing completely if it's too far gone!
